The role
We are looking for a Senior Network Engineer to design, build, and operate large-scale, high-performance data center networks supporting GPU-dense AI workloads. You will take end-to-end ownership of service provider–grade and CLOS-based network infrastructure, ensuring reliability, scalability, and predictable performance across distributed environments. This role requires deep expertise in routing, switching, and modern data center fabrics, with a strong focus on production operations, root cause analysis, and continuous improvement of network systems.
Responsibilities
- Design and evolve scalable data center network architectures (CLOS/leaf-spine) for high-throughput, low-latency environments.
- Own end-to-end deployment and lifecycle management of routing and switching infrastructure across production environments.
- Develop and maintain network design documentation, standards, and operational procedures.
- Plan, execute, and validate network infrastructure testing, including vendor evaluation and benchmarking.
- Diagnose and resolve complex network issues across the TCP/IPv4/v6 stack in large-scale distributed environments.
- Optimize traffic engineering, ECMP, and load balancing strategies to ensure efficient utilization of network resources.
- Implement and operate MPLS-based technologies, including L3 VPNs and segment routing (SR-MPLS, SRv6).
- Collaborate with hardware, systems, and software teams to integrate networking with compute and storage infrastructure.
- Automate network operations and workflows to improve reliability, scalability, and operational efficiency.
- Ensure high availability and performance of production networks through proactive monitoring and continuous improvement.
Requirements
- Expert-level knowledge (CCIE/JNCIE or equivalent) in MPLS, routing, and switching for service provider and data center networks.
- Strong experience with Ethernet switching, VXLAN, and modern cloud overlay networking technologies.
- Deep expertise in routing protocols including BGP and IS-IS.
- Hands-on experience with segment routing (SR-MPLS, SRv6), L3 MPLS VPNs, and ECMP-based traffic balancing.
- Proven experience designing and documenting large-scale network architectures.
- Experience developing and executing network testing strategies and validating vendor solutions.
- Strong troubleshooting skills across the TCP/IPv4/v6 stack in CLOS-based data center environments.
- Solid understanding of network hardware architecture, QoS mechanisms, and packet processing pipelines.
- Hands-on experience with network equipment from vendors such as Juniper, Arista, Huawei, and Mellanox.
